The Benefits of Mindful Breathing

Mindful breathing is a technique that involves focusing your attention on your breath, allowing you to be present in the moment and let go of distractions. This practice has numerous benefits, including:

  • Reduced stress and anxiety
  • Improved concentration and focus
  • Enhanced self-awareness
  • Promotion of relaxation and calmness
  • Increased emotional regulation

How to Practice Mindful Breathing

Here is a simple guide to help you get started with mindful breathing:

  1. Find a quiet and comfortable place to sit or lie down.
  2. Close your eyes and take a few deep breaths to relax your body.
  3. Focus your attention on your breath as you inhale and exhale.
  4. Notice the sensation of the air entering and leaving your nostrils or the rise and fall of your chest.
  5. If your mind starts to wander, gently bring your focus back to your breath without judgment.
  6. Continue this practice for a few minutes or as long as you feel comfortable.
